denturesYou may not realize this, but if you have recently begun wearing full dentures in Weatherford, you have joined a growing number of U.S. adults that have false teeth. In fact, according to the National Health and Nutrition Examination Survey, 57 percent of Americans ages 65 to 74 and 51 percent of those ages 55 to 64 have full or partial dentures. It is not uncommon for patients with new dentures to feel slight discomfort or irritation at first – but do not worry. In recent years, more dentists and orthodontists have seen the benefit of providing both phase 1 and phase 2 orthodontic treatments. This combined approach to orthodontics allows our team to eliminate many jaw and skull bone shape and alignment issues while children still have their baby teeth, allowing patients to achieve their desired bite positioning more quickly and comfortably.
